Norway -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Pollution in Manufacturing
Since 2012, Norway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Pollution in Manufacturing decreased by 35.7% year on year. In 2017, the country was number 22 among other countries in Environmentally Related Tax Revenue from Taxes on Pollution in Manufacturing with $3.51 Million. Norway is overtaken by Czech Republic, which was ranked number 21 at $3.57 Million and is followed by Bulgaria with $3.13 Million. United Kingdom ranked the highest with $240.64 Million in 2019, that is -2.5% versus 2018. France, Netherlands and Poland resp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Hungary recorded the best 5 years average growth at +10.5% per year, while Norway witnessed the worst performance at -35.7% per year.
